Rocky Mountains, major mountain system of W North America and easternmost belt of the North American cordillera, extending more than 3,000 mi (4,800 km) from central N.Mex. to NW Alaska; Mt. Elbert (14,431 ft/4,399 m) in Colorado is the highest peak. The Rockies are located between the Great Plains on the east (from which they rise abruptly for most of their length) and a series of broad basins and plateaus on the west.
The mountains form the Continental Divide, separating rivers draining to the Atlantic and Arctic oceans from those draining to the Pacific. The major Atlantic-bound rivers rising in the Rockies include the Rio Grande, Arkansas, Platte, Yellowstone, Missouri, and Saskatchewan. Those draining to the Arctic include the Peace, Athabasca, and Liard rivers. Flowing to the Pacific Ocean are the Colorado, Columbia, Snake, Fraser, and Yukon rivers. TopographyTopographically, the Rockies are usually divided into five sections: the Southern Rockies, Middle Rockies, Northern Rockies (all in the United States), the Rocky Mountain system of Canada, and Brooks Range in Alaska. The Wyoming Basin, the system's principal topographic break, is sometimes considered a sixth section. The Southern Rockies, in New Mexico, Colorado, and S Wyoming, are dominated by two north-south belts of folded mountains that have been eroded to expose cores of Precambrian rocks rimmed by younger sedimentary rocks. The eastern belt comprises the Laramie, Medicine Bow, and Wet Mts. and the Front Range. The principal ranges of the western belt are the Park, Gore, Mosquito, Sawatch, and Sangre de Cristo. Between the two belts are three basins known as the North, South, and Middle "parks." To the southwest are the San Juan Mts., a nonlinear group of uplands composed mainly of volcanic rocks. The Southern Rockies are the system's highest section and include many peaks above 14,000 ft (4,267 m), among them Mt. Elbert and Mt. Massive (14,418 ft/4,395 m), both in the Sawatch Mts. The Middle Rockies, chiefly in NE Utah and W Wyoming, lie N of the Southern Rockies and are separated from them by the Wyoming Basin. The ranges of this section are generally lower and less continuous than those to the south. The principal parts are the Wasatch and Teton ranges (which are both great tilted fault blocks), the Yellowstone Plateau and Absaroka Range (both developed on volcanic rocks), the Bighorn, Beartooth, Owl Creek, and Uinta Mts., and the Wind River Range (all broad folded mountains). All of these component sections have been eroded down to their Precambrian cores and are rimmed by Paleozoic and Mesozoic sedimentary rocks. The highest peaks of the Middle Rockies are Gannet Peak (13,785 ft/4,202 m) in the Wind River Range and Grand Teton (13,766 ft/4,196 m) in the Teton Range. The Rocky Mt. system of Canada is composed of two major sections: the high rugged peaks of the Canadian Rockies proper, to the east, and the Columbia Mts. group on the west. The Canadian Rockies are located along the British Columbia–Alberta border and include Mt. Robson (12,972 ft/3,954 m; highest peak of the Rocky Mts. in Canada), Mt. Columbia (12,295 ft/3,748 m), and Mt. Forbes (11,902 ft/3,628 m). The prominent, wide-floored Rocky Mountain Trench, west of the crest line, continues c.800 mi (1,290 km) into Canada from Montana and is drained by the headwaters of the Peace River and by sections of the Fraser, Columbia, and Kootenay rivers. The Purcell Trench to the west also crosses into Canada and joins the Rocky Mountain Trench c.200 mi (320 km) north of the border. Farther to the west is the Columbia Mts. group, which includes the Selkirk, Purcell, Monashee, and Cariboo Mts. The Rockies continue into the Yukon Territory and Northwest Territories as the Mackenzie, Richardson, and Franklin Mts. In N Alaska, the Brooks Range, a cold and treeless region rising to Mt. Chamberlin (9,020 ft/2,749 m), forms the northernmost section of the Rocky Mts. Economy and Natural ResourcesExploitable mineral deposits (lead, zinc, copper, silver, gold) are sparsely dispersed throughout the entire system. The principal mining centers are Leadville and Cripple Creek, Colo.; the Butte-Anaconda district of Montana; Coeur d'Alene, Idaho; and the Kootenay Trail region of British Columbia. In the 1970s oil shale found in the Rocky Mt. area led to an oil industry that spurred city and state growth, especially in Colorado; by the mid-1980s, the industry was already in decline. Vast forests, largely under government control and supervision, are a major natural resource. Lumbering and other forestry activities are limited mainly to Montana, Idaho, and British Columbia, where commercially valuable stands are most abundant and accessible. The Rockies are a year-round recreational attraction, and the surrounding states have seen a boom in vacation-housing construction and, thus, population increases since the late 1970s. Chronic, Time, Rocks, and the Rockies (1984); J. McPhee, Rising From the Plains (1986). Rocky Mountainsor RockiesMountain system, western North America. It extends some 3,000 mi (4,800 km) from the Mexican frontier to the Arctic Ocean, through the western U.S. and Canada. The highest peak in the U.S. Rockies is Mount Elbert in Colorado, at 14,433 ft (4,399 m); in the Canadian Rockies it is Mount Robson in British Columbia, at 12,972 ft (3,954 m). The Continental Divide, located in the mountains, separates rivers flowing to the east and to the west. Wildlife includes grizzly bear, brown bear, elk, bighorn sheep, and cougar. The area is rich in deposits of copper, iron ore, silver, gold, lead, zinc, phosphate, potash, and gypsum. Rocky Mountain, Yellowstone, and Grand Teton national parks in the U.S. are major recreational facilities. Rocky Mountains a mountain system in the western part of North America, in Canada and the United States. The Rocky Mountains extend from 60°N lat. to 32°N lat., a total length of approximately 3,200 km. They are 700 km wide at their widest point. The mountains form the chief part of the eastern belt of the Cordilleras of North America. In a structural and orographic sense the Rocky Mountains comprise two divisions. The Northern Rockies, extending north from 45°N lat., are distinguished by compactness and by the great length of their ranges and valleys, which run from the northwest to the southeast. Many of the peaks rise above 3,500 m (Mount Columbia, 3,747 m; Mount Robson, 3,954 m). The principal orographic element of the Southern Rockies is the Front Range, with a length of approximately 2,000 km. In the west, this range is bounded by a narrow tectonic depression called the Rocky Mountain Trench. The Southern Rockies, extending south from 45°N lat., are more mosaic, and it is here that the system attains its greatest width. Low and high (4,000 m and more) ranges alternate in relief; they run in different directions and are divided by vast plateau-like basins called parks. The highest peak of the Southern Rockies and of the entire system is Mount Elbert (4,399 m). The Rocky Mountains were formed in the age of Laramide folding (late Cretaceous-Paleogene) and then were subjected to intensive recent uplifting. The northern part of the Rocky Mountains emerged in the area of an ancient foredeep, which separated the Cordilleran geosyncline from the stable part of the North American craton. The Southern Rockies were created on the foundation of ancient cratonic structures that are incorporated into the mobile zone of orogeny. Mountain-forming processes continue today, manifesting themselves in earthquakes and such postvolcanic phenomena as the geysers of Yellowstone National Park. The northern part of the Rocky Mountains is characterized by a complex of landforms from earlier glacial stages. Deposits of gold, silver, copper, and complex ores are confined to the axial parts of the ranges and the massifs composed primarily of Precambrian crystalline rocks. Coal and petroleum deposits are related to sedimentary Paleozoic strata, which form the peripheral parts of the folded ranges. The Rocky Mountains are located in the temperate and subtropical zones, and the climate is mostly continental. On the peaks and western slopes, precipitation can amount to 1,000 mm a year. The snowline is 4,000 m in the south and 2,500 m in the north. Some of North America’s major rivers, such as the Missouri, Rio Grande, Columbia, and Colorado, originate in the Rockies. The soil and vegetative cover represent several high-altitude zones. In the north there are montane forests (white spruce, alpine fir), elfin forests, alpine tundra, and bald mountains. In the south, the zones include grasslands, parks, primarily pine (western yellow, white, and shore pines), subalpine dark-needled forests (the spruce Picea engelmannii, giant fir), and alpine meadows. The timberline is at an elevation of 3,600 m in the south and 1,200–1,500 m in the north. Mountain fauna includes the grizzly bear, Rocky Mountain goat, argali, and cougar. Among the many parks in the Rocky Mountains are the Jasper, Banff, Yoho, and Glacier national parks (in Canada) and the Rocky Mountain and Yellowstone national parks in the United States. G. M.
